Searched refs:TripMultiple (Results 1 – 3 of 3) sorted by relevance
| /freebsd-10-stable/contrib/llvm/lib/Transforms/Utils/ |
| D | LoopUnroll.cpp | 142 bool AllowRuntime, unsigned TripMultiple, in UnrollLoop() argument 181 if (TripMultiple != 1) in UnrollLoop() 182 DEBUG(dbgs() << " Trip Multiple = " << TripMultiple << "\n"); in UnrollLoop() 195 assert(TripMultiple > 0); in UnrollLoop() 196 assert(TripCount == 0 || TripCount % TripMultiple == 0); in UnrollLoop() 221 TripMultiple = 0; in UnrollLoop() 224 BreakoutTrip = TripMultiple = in UnrollLoop() 225 (unsigned)GreatestCommonDivisor64(Count, TripMultiple); in UnrollLoop() 234 if (TripMultiple == 0 || BreakoutTrip != TripMultiple) { in UnrollLoop() 236 } else if (TripMultiple != 1) { in UnrollLoop() [all …]
|
| /freebsd-10-stable/contrib/llvm/lib/Transforms/Scalar/ |
| D | LoopUnrollPass.cpp | 179 unsigned TripMultiple = 1; in runOnLoop() local 186 TripMultiple = SE->getSmallConstantTripMultiple(L, LatchBlock); in runOnLoop() 256 if (!UnrollLoop(L, Count, TripCount, Runtime, TripMultiple, LI, &LPM)) in runOnLoop()
|
| /freebsd-10-stable/contrib/llvm/include/llvm/Transforms/Utils/ |
| D | UnrollLoop.h | 26 unsigned TripMultiple, LoopInfo* LI, LPPassManager* LPM);
|